Nettet2. jan. 2024 · Since July 1, 2024, a valid EICR is required for all new tenancies. The report must also be passed on to your tenant within 28 days of the inspection being carried out. If the report comes back and work is needed to bring your property’s electrics up to standard, this must be done within 28 days – or sooner if the report dictates. NettetOn a tenanted domestic property, this is required every 5 years, or at change of occupancy. Communal areas of flats fall under the commercial side of electrical installation, and therefore require an EICR to be carried out at least every 5 years.
